BSNL launches Prepaid Plan 225 with 30 days Validity

October 14, 2025 by Amiya Leave a Comment

BSNL Introduces New Rs 225 Prepaid Plan, validity 30 days: A Step in the right direction before Swadeshi 4G Rolls Out.

Bharat Sanchar Nigam Limited (BSNL) has recently launched a new prepaid plan of 225 in a massive move to support its prepaid-based products and as a precursor to the roll out of its indigenous 4G network countrywide. The plan is a competitive combination of voice, data and SMS benefits with a 30 days lifespan, the plan is a competitive one and thus it can be said as a good competitor in the budget high segment of the Indian telecom market.

What the Rs 225 Plan Offers

The new BSNL prepaid plan or BSNL Rs 225 offers unlimited local and STD voice calls, 100 SMS per day and unlimited high-speed data of up to 2.5GB in a day. Beyond the daily bandwidth quota, internet connections are limited to 40 Kbps, which is the usual policy of most Indian telecom companies to prevent network congestion and guarantee access.

The plan has a 30 days validity, which fits well with the monthly usages, which means that it is convenient to regular users who want to know what to expect in terms of bills and other good services. In its Portfolio, the Competitive Landscape in BSNL.

The Rs 225 plan will fit in the current portfolio of cheap prepaid plans offered by BSNL. It is added to other related products like:

Plan of Rs 228: 2GB/day data (40 Kbps after limit) includes unlimited calls, 100 SMS/day, and is valid 30 days.
Rs 229 plan: Same benefits as Rs 228
Rs 199 plan: 2GB/day data, unlimited calls, 100 SMS/day but with a reduced period of 28 days.

The price and benefits differences between these plans are negligible, but the fact that BSNL is introducing the Rs 225 variant indicates that it is refining its pricing approach – either to provide more psychological pricing (with an ending of 5 or 9) or to build some promotional bundle space within certain telecommunity circles.

In addition to the sub-Rs 250 market, BSNL also has an extensive variety of plans with longer durations serving the needs of various types of users:

Rs 299: 3GB/day, unlimited calls, 100 SMS/day, 30 day validity.
Rs 347: 2GB/day, 50-day validity
Rs 599: 3GB/day, 84-day validity
Rs 997: 2GB/day, 160-day validity
Rs 1999: 1.5GB/day, 330-day validity
Rs 2399: 2GB/day, 365-day validity

It is interesting that the Rs 247 is designed differently, where it has a talk value of Rs 10 and a total data of 50GB (not per day), and thus, it suits a user with a medium amount of data usage but more calling usage.
